Car
If you are driving in Val Venosta, Churburg is located at Castel Coira, 1, 39020 Schluderns BZ. From the main road SS38, take the exit for Schluderns. Follow the signs for Schluderns and then for Churburg. The castle is well-marked and has a parking area nearby. Parking might incur a small fee, so be prepared with some coins.
Public Transportation
If you prefer public transportation, take a train to the nearest station, which is in Mals. From Mals, you can catch a bus towards Schluderns. The bus stop you want is 'Schluderns - Churburg'. The bus service is relatively frequent, but it’s advisable to check the local timetable in advance. Note that the bus fare is about €2-€3.
Walking from Schluderns
If you are already in Schluderns, Churburg is about a 15-20 minute walk from the village center. Head towards the main road, then follow the signs directing you to Churburg. The walk is scenic and allows you to enjoy the beautiful views of the Val Venosta landscape.
